JD McCoy, DC,CCSP

Dr. McCoy subspecializes in sports medicine and provides chiropractic care to his patients. With extensive education and training in sports medicine, as well as numerous techniques in chiropractic care - he is fully equipped to care for patients with a full spectrum of musculoskeletal conditions.

Chiropractic treatment is not always about adjustments. Dr. McCoy provides sports therapy and other lighter techniques like therapeutic exercises and myofascial release for muscle strains and joint sprains. And if an issue is outside of his scope, he will refer his patients to the most appropriate provider to ensure optimal care for his patients.

He found his passion for sports medicine through his own background in sports, as well as, during his time serving in the United States Army. Dr. McCoy enjoys treating athletes and individuals achieve their goals and to “keep them going” and getting them back to activities they love most.

Outside of his clinical work, he plans to focus his research on how chiropractic and traditional medicine complement each other in helping patients with musculoskeletal issues. He feels it is important for both the referring physician and patient understand the true effectiveness of adding chiropractic care into a traditional medical treatment plan using evidence-based research.

When Dr. McCoy is not spending time in the clinic, he enjoys working out, spending time with his wife and four children, and going to the shooting range.
